SUMMARY:Essential Matwork School Run Friendly Course (Teach)
DESCRIPTION:This course will give you the new nationally recognised qualification YMCA Awards Level 3 Diploma in Teaching Pilates (Practitioner) regulated by Ofqual and supported by CIMSPA (Chartered Institute for the Management of Sport and Physical Activity) \nIt covers; \nAll class content – to include warm up\, cool down and stretch \nPrinciples and fundamentals \nPre – Pilates \n34 original exercises \nProgression and modification \nPostural analysis\, core stability and movement analysis \nOverview of special populations in exercise \nTeaching and communication skills \n\nThe following key skills and knowledge are assessed through YMCA awards assessment procedure: \n\n\n\n\nAnatomy and Physiology required when exercise programming and design for a range of clients\nImportance of professionalism\, customer service\, effective communication and interpersonal skills\nKnowledge and understanding of commonly occurring medically controlled diseases and health conditions\nUnderstanding the principles and fundamentals of Pilates\nHow to programme a Pilates session\nHow to instruct a Pilates session\n\n\n\n\n\nThis assessment includes: \nA multiple choice exam for Level 3 applied anatomy and physiology \nOnline questions and written worksheets \nA 12 week progressive programme\, and viva \nA detailed lesson plan for a matwork group class – practical teaching assessment \n\nSchool Run Friendly course runs term time only 10 – 1.30 Thursday + several Sundays for specialist lectures \nFollowed by YMCA awards Assessment \nCost: £2000 in advance (includes a free FiP course when paid in advance) \nInstallment £500 deposit and 8 monthly payment of £215  \n\nProvisional dates\nJune 2021- February  2022

SUMMARY:Back pathology and movement directions - a special population course (Teach)
DESCRIPTION:Back Pathology and movement direction – Sally Roberts 1 day \nThis workshop has been developed to help us gain a good understanding of the common range of pathologies we come across in our work. Each participant is given a topic to research and present to the rest of the group\, which will be discussed and reviewed by Sally. \n\nPsychology of chronic Lower back pain\nHypermobility Syndrome\nBack Surgery\, and post operative long term management\nScoliosis\nExtension related lumbar spine to include spondilolythesis and facet joint syndrome\nSacro–iliac Joint Dysfunction (SIJ)\nWhiplash\nDisc related injuries\nAnkylosing Spondylitis\nThoracic spine issues and thoracic outlet syndrome\n\nMovement Direction Considerations \nWe will workshop each movement direction\, the emphasis of the exercise\, movement faults and cautions/contraindications. From the clients’ medical history and postural presentation we may choose to modify the exercises or exclude exercises. \nThe consideration of movement direction is useful when putting together a balanced class. Namely: flexion\, extension\, rotation\, side flexion both in the trunk and peripherals. The layering of more complex movements should be integrated as the client progresses. The evaluation of how a client performs in a particular direction of movement informs us how we will facilitate improvements in the execution of the exercise. \n Cost £175 (early bird £150 booked 4 weeks in advance) \nDiscounts for PiN £120
